Output 625cdb667365316f7dee4fa998fa7025ae15042153ccf847b5622ad0caf8e3a3:5

value
17259870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 064b91d71fd1e1982f6c815bb85f695384d54921 OP_EQUAL
address
M8USpFkjq6dvs7kYVV3APWTC7FMgtmateM
transaction
625cdb667365316f7dee4fa998fa7025ae15042153ccf847b5622ad0caf8e3a3
spent
true